Nestled among the majestic hills of Italy, lies the micro-state of San Marino, often referred to as to be the world's oldest surviving republic. Founded in 301 AD, it get more info boasts a history rich with cultural traditions that persist to this day. Through the centuries, San Marino has remained its sovereign entity, withstanding numerous trials.

Today, it persists as a popular tourist destination, luring visitors with its breathtaking landscapes and historic architecture. A visit to San Marino is a journey through time, offering a window into the past and the enduring spirit of this extraordinary nation.
